Glucagonoma is a rare pancreatic neuroendocrine tumor that secretes an excess of glucagon. One of the hallmark skin conditions associated with glucagonoma is necrolytic migratory erythema. This condition presents as erythematous, blistering and crusting lesions that can occur on the groin, buttocks, and other areas of the body. The lesions are often described as migrating and can be painful and pruritic. The presence of necrolytic migratory erythema is linked to the hyperglycemic effects of glucagon, which leads to an increase in the metabolism of amino acids and may result in a deficiency of essential fatty acids, contributing to the characteristic skin findings. Recognizing necrolytic migratory erythema in patients with suspected glucagonoma can lead to early diagnosis and management of this malignancy, making it an essential concept in understanding the systemic effects of glucagon-secreting tumors.
